Transaction 22710971c21a188ae992a2cf5c2a0bbf36d9bafc0d0d5ee7f8ea93d54f0fecd3
1 Input
2 Outputs
- 22710971c21a188ae992a2cf5c2a0bbf36d9bafc0d0d5ee7f8ea93d54f0fecd3:0
- 22710971c21a188ae992a2cf5c2a0bbf36d9bafc0d0d5ee7f8ea93d54f0fecd3:1
value 20000000000
address 3HAmBUqKTgxS6VuECrkFCAGtUSSyLa6uqr
value 9992045004
address 16MrRM5s4kGUBgK9CJbJGiH5dLQMMs84kU